比特币区块链是一个去中心化的公共账本,记录了所有比特币交易的历史。每个区块中包含了一些交易信息以及指向前一个区块的加密哈希,这使得所有的区块按顺序连接在一起,形成了一个链条。每当一笔新的比特币交易发生时,这笔交易会被广播到比特币网络的节点中,经过矿工验证后,才会被打包进新的区块中并添加到链上。由于区块链的透明性和不可篡改性,比特币的交易记录可以被任何人查看,从而确保了其安全性。
比特币区块链的每个区块都包含以下几个基本部分: 1. **区块头**:包含版本号、时间戳、前一区块的哈希值、默克尔根(Merkle Root)和难度目标(difficulty target)。 2. **交易计数**:记录区块中包含的交易的数量。 3. **交易列表**:所有在该区块中确认的交易信息。 区块头中的前一区块哈希值确保了区块链的连贯性;而默克尔根则是当前区块中所有交易的哈希值而形成的单一哈希值,用于校验区块内交易的完整性。
下载比特币区块链文件通常需要使用比特币客户端(如Bitcoin Core)。用户可以通过以下步骤进行下载: 1. **安装比特币客户端**:访问比特币官网(bitcoin.org),下载并安装合适的客户端版本。 2. **启动客户端**:安装完成后,首次启动客户端时,它会自动开始下载区块链,过程可能需要长达数小时甚至几天,具体取决于网络速度和硬盘性能。 3. **数据存储位置**:下载的区块链文件通常存储在本地计算机的指定文件夹中,用户可以通过客户端设置更改该路径。
比特币区块链的设计注重安全性和隐私保护。交易记录一旦被写入区块链就无法更改,此外,比特币交易并不直接关联具体的个人身份,而是通过地址(address)进行操作。这为用户提供了相对较高的隐私保护。用户在使用比特币时,可以创建不同的地址来进行交易,从而使其交易历史难以追踪。 然而,尽管比特币提供了一定的匿名性,但通过链上数据分析,技术高超的个人或机构仍然有可能揭示某些用户的身份,因此用户在进行比特币交易时仍需谨慎,避免暴露过多个人信息。
比特币的区块链除了用于记录比特币交易外,还有广泛的应用场景。例如: 1. **智能合约**:利用区块链技术,可创建自动化的合约,确保合约条件在达成时自动执行。 2. **供应链管理**:通过区块链记录货物在供应链中的每一步,有助于提高透明度和追踪效率。 3. **数字身份验证**:将个人身份信息存储在区块链上,可以降低身份盗用的风险,增强用户对其身份的控制权。 随着技术的发展,越来越多的行业开始探索基于区块链的解决方案,这为比特币及其底层技术的应用打开了无限可能。
比特币区块链的大小随着时间的推移而不断增加,截至2023年,区块链的数据约在500GB左右。随着比特币交易的增加,这个数据量也在持续攀升,因此存储空间是使用比特币全节点的重要考虑因素。可以通过运行轻量级客户端或使用网络服务来避免存储整条链的需求。
确保比特币交易安全性的关键在于保护私钥和采取防范措施。用户应该将私钥存储在安全的地方,例如硬件钱包或冷钱包,并避免在网络上分享私钥。此外,使用双重验证和强密码也是防止被盗的重要措施,建议定期检查账户的活动记录,及时发现异常交易。
可扩展性问题是指随着用户和交易数量的增加,区块链仍然能够高效处理交易的能力。比特币区块链每个区块的大小和产生速率都有限制,这很可能导致交易拥堵以及确认时间变长。虽然通过扩展区块大小或通过闪电网络等解决方案都有提升,但仍需持续探索和研究以找到最佳解决方法。
比特币的去中心化是指没有中央权威来控制网络或处理交易。每个用户都可以参与到网络中并拥有相同的权利,通过共识机制,网络中去中心化的节点共同验证交易的真实性。这种特性避免了一些传统金融系统面临的单点故障问题,并加强了安全性和透明度,有利于增强用户对系统的信任。
比特币区块链的未来发展趋势将受到技术、市场需求及监管环境的影响。方向包括技术层面的,如闪电网络和第二层解决方案的实施;去中心化金融(DeFi)的蓬勃发展让更多人接入加密金融世界;同时,合规与监管的加强会促使比特币进入更多传统金融领域,带来更广泛的应用场景。同时,随着公众对区块链技术的理解和接受度的提高,比特币在金融领域的影响力将进一步扩大。
通过上述内容,可以看出比特币区块链的复杂性和多样性。希望通过深入的了解,能够帮助读者更好地掌握比特币的知识,并在未来的交易中更为得心应手。